Martins301: Although there are many factors that has lead to the continous fall in the value of the Naira, I am going to concentrate on just one in this piece.
I remember going to the bank sometime in 2013. I had some Western Union transaction to carry out. After filling the necessary forms and presenting the proper documentation, I was shocked when my currency (Dollar) was forcefully changed to Naira against my wish. The bank personnel who attended to me said it was the [b]new CBN policy to always convert foreign currency to local currency before paying out to customers.
I told her that this singular act will cause the Naira to depreciate further before the year ends and will cause the value of the Naira to continously spiral downwards if the policy is not reversed She laughed it off, saying it won't. But my prediction came to pass and it is still holding true till today.
Ceteris paribus, the price of a commodity will rise if the commodity becomes scare. By that singular policy, CBN has made Dollar very scarce in the market and has thus caused the price or value of the Dollar to rise against the Naira. BDC operators are willing to pay a higher price for $1 since it is scare. This pressure from the parallel market is also carried into the official market as banks (who know they now have the larger share of the available foreign currency) also hoard it, in the hope of profiting from its appreciation against the Naira. Simply put, CBN has indirectly created artificial scarcity of the Naira in the parallel market and the resulting pressure from that market is what is pushing the value of the Naira down against other foreign currencies.
I believe that if CBN reverses this policy, the pressure on the Naira won't be too much and we can expect the Naira to start holding its own ground against other currencies. Otherwise, expect the Naira to fall further.
